Compensation
- Total compensation: 65,000 - 110,000 EUR
- The total compensation range listed here has been provided to comply with local regulations and represents a potential total compensation range for this role. Please note that actual total compensation may vary within the range above or below, depending on experience and location. We look at compensation for each individual and base our offer on your unique qualifications, experience, and expected contributions. This position's total compensation may be composed of other types of compensation, such as variable bonus and/or stock bonus.

What We Do
Veeva is the global leader in cloud software for the life sciences industry. Committed to innovation, product excellence, and customer success, Veeva serves more than 1,000 customers, ranging from the world’s largest pharmaceutical companies to emerging biotechs. As a Public Benefit Corporation, Veeva is committed to balancing the interests of all stakeholders, including customers, employees, shareholders, and the industries it serves.
